Ordering Tips
Treat a visit to Mirror Twin as a tasting progression: start with a flight to sample a range, then order a full pour of the beer that holds your attention. The recommended sequence runs light-to-dark and low-ABV-to-high-ABV—session styles first, then move toward barrel-aged or imperial offerings. That graduated approach helps you track subtle differences on a rotating tap list and avoid jumping too quickly into high-ABV or heavily aged beers. Arrive with the intention of building a sequence rather than ordering what’s familiar.

Bar context
Against Lexington's bar options, Mirror Twin Brewing occupies a specific and fairly narrow lane: casual, neighborhood-facing, low-pressure. If you want a more polished experience, 21c Museum Hotel Lexington is the clear upgrade; the bar program there operates inside a boutique hotel with art throughout, the overall experience is more considered. It's harder to walk into without a plan, but the environment rewards the effort. Mirror Twin is the easier, more spontaneous call.
Al's Bar and Arcadium Bar compete more directly with Mirror Twin for the casual-evening crowd. Al's skews toward a dive-bar register; Arcadium leans into a games-and-drinks format. If your group wants activity alongside drinks, Arcadium is the better pick. If you want a quieter drink without a gimmick, Mirror Twin and Al's are closer alternatives. 369 W Vine St sits closer to the cocktail-bar end of the spectrum and works if the quality of the drink in your hand matters more than the format around it.
For food-forward drinking, Corto Lima is the strongest alternative in the city; it pairs a serious drinks program with a kitchen, which Mirror Twin does not appear to match on available data. If you're planning a full evening rather than a casual stop, Corto Lima is the more complete option. Mirror Twin is best positioned as part of a wider Distillery District crawl rather than a standalone destination.
